Water Quality: Rock Island, WA
2 water systems • 3,523 people served
No Health ViolationsWater Quality Summary
Rock Island is served by 2 public water systems with a combined service population of 3,523 people, and has 24 EPA Safe Drinking Water Act violations on record. None of those violations are health-based — the records reflect missed monitoring or reporting deadlines rather than a contaminant exceeding safe levels. Rock Island's violation count is 85% below the national average for Washington.
Water Systems Serving Rock Island
| System Name | PWSID | Source | Population | Violations |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Rock Island Water Dept City of | WA5373401 | Groundwater | 3,226 | 14 |
| CRO FARMS INC | WA5314174 | Groundwater | 297 | 10 |
